Tamkeen backs 70 Bahraini firms at industry fair

Manama, February 5, 2014

Bahrain's labour fund Tamkeen said 70 Bahrain-based enterprises taking part in the Gulf Industry Fair 2014, the leading business-to-business (B2B) event in the Northern Gulf, have been supported by its “Tarweej” scheme.

The Tamkeen move comes as part of its efforts to contribute to the growth and development of Bahraini enterprises, said a company official.

"As one of Tamkeen's key support programmes, Tarweej provides enterprises with the opportunity to expand their customer base and promote awareness about their products and services through participation in local, regional, and international exhibitions where Tamkeen offers 80 per cent of the overall participation cost," remarked Mohammed Bucheeri, the VP for private sector support.

To date, more than 7,600 enterprises in Bahrain have benefited from Tamkeen’s Enterprise Development Support Programme (EDS), he stated.

Besides, the 'Tarweej' scheme, the EDS also includes “Istishara”  to assist in strategic planning and determining vision and goals of the organisation, the 'Techania' to support purchase of latest enterprise-related tools and equipment, 'Jawda' to assist in the design, application of quality standards, 'Tasweeq' to offer support in design and implementation of effective marketing, and the Legal Services Support Scheme, which provides enterprises with legal support in their commercial transactions, he added.-TradeArabia News Service
